Transaction 34b9cedf19f142cbf711aaf8c1014500f1dda7e1cd8922f41f53b7fce01b0919

block
fd54ecca1b1a08e32a022a91c5130b48365dc45de25a77844b4aa400c359371d

1 Input

2 Outputs